As promised here is another peek at the all new SWALK stamps by Crafters Companion which launch on Create and Craft on Saturday 12th February. There is a set of 6 stamp plates with the oh so cute images and sentiments that are just a little bit different.

I used the SWALK 2 CD ROM to print the DP direct to some Snow White Centura Pearl card. I cut a round aperture in the front of the card using nesties and added stickles around the edge. I coloured the image with DI and cut it out with a circular nestie which I then layered onto another scalloped edge nestie and stuck to the inside of the card.  The sentiment is also from the stamp plate and the flowers were printed from the CD then cut out and distressed by scrunching them up then edged with stickles. The flourish was cut using my Slice machine.

Thought you might like to see some more of the cards I made for the launch of Crafters Companion's Popcorn Kids range of CD & stamps.  This is a fabulous collection, if you are not into stamping there is plenty on the CD to keep you busy but if like me you love stamping then you are in for a real treat. Combine the two, CD and stamps and you have a wealth of creativity at your fingertips. These Popcorn stamps are smaller than the previous ones so lend themselves to the 6x6 cards that are so popular. They also work so well with the nestability diecuts.
The easel card at the top of this post is made using a old CD.  To this I've added nestie circles and used the Happy Birthday stamp from the set and the so cute Biscuit the dog coloured with Whispers.


For the card below I used a scalloped circle of Bazill card folded in  half.  I created the lattice using an MS wide border punch.  For the decoupaged image I printed off  4 of the image sheets and created the layering myself.  I love creating decoupage from scratch, to me it's half the fun decided just what to cut away. I varnished the strawberries, added pearl dimensional paint dots to the edge and made the bow from my ribbon stash.

Another stepper card made from pearl card and printed with a design from the CD.  All the images and sentiments are stamped and coloured with Whispers.
